In a recent post, Starbreeze excitedly declares, “We’ve just completed our first day of Payday 3’s Play Early period,” and proceeds to unveil some jaw-dropping statistics that shed light on the audacious world of heisting. The statistics, presented in an image accompanying the post, begin with the number of secured bags.
So far, players have executed over three million heists, amassing a jaw-dropping 200 million in illicit cash. Equally impressive are the early access kill numbers, which have surged past 20 million. The statistics also reveal the most popular heists, with “No Rest for the Wicked” taking the top spot, closely followed by “Road Rage.” The third position is claimed by “Dirty Ice.”
It seems that loud heists have a magnetic appeal or are simply easier to execute, as they have attracted over 200,000 more participants than their stealthy counterparts. For those curious about the game’s top weapons, the CAR-4, Reinfeld 880, and SA A114 seem to dominate, although they’ve also been used for unintended civilian casualties (to the tune of a couple of thousand) and dispatching over a million adversaries. Impressively, more than 300,000 shots have landed as critical hits.
Additionally, the early access community appears to value teamwork and camaraderie, with nearly half a million revivals recorded.
